Scripture of the Wandering Goddess

“The Path of Virtual Worlds” — the foundational teachings that define our theology and practice.

Section 1
The Nature of the Wandering Goddess
  • 1.1 There is one Goddess who walks the virtual worlds.
  • 1.2 She manifests within the digital realms created by human imagination, appearing only once in each world before moving on.
  • 1.3 She guides sincere Seekers toward growth, skill, purpose, and joy.
Section 2
The Purpose of Life
  • 2.1 Every person is born into the physical world to learn, improve, and prepare for the next stage of existence.
  • 2.2 Upon bodily death, the faithful soul journeys to a Final Virtual World — an eternal digital realm where the Goddess dwells.
  • 2.3 Entry into this realm is earned through exploration, kindness, determination, and continual self-betterment.
Section 3
Sacred Exploration
  • 3.1 The virtual worlds of video games are sacred places created through the combined inspiration of human creativity and divine guidance.
  • 3.2 The Goddess teaches through quests, characters, challenges, storylines, and the worlds themselves.
  • 3.3 Each encounter reveals lessons about patience, courage, empathy, strategy, variety, action, and acceptance.
Section 4
Commandments of Practice
  • 4.1 Seekers shall explore new virtual worlds regularly, for stagnation displeases the Goddess.
  • 4.2 Hatred, cruelty, and procrastination are obstacles to her presence.
  • 4.3 Helping characters, resolving conflicts, advancing stories, improving abilities, and completing journeys please the Goddess.
  • 4.4 Daily Ceremonies: the First begins before sunrise; the Second later in the day; each lasts no less than two hours; controllers are cleansed beforehand; prayers begin and end each Ceremony.
  • 4.5 Because the Goddess appears only once in each world, Seekers must change games as needed to continue their sacred journey.
  • 4.6 Seekers shall use their own game console for each Ceremony.
  • 4.7 Seekers meet at least weekly to share lessons, so all may benefit from the Goddess’s teachings.
  • 4.8 Seekers must keep their physical bodies in good condition: at least one hour outdoors in contemplation or exercise each day.
  • 4.9 Devotion shall not cause family or work life to suffer; there will be time eternal in the Final Virtual World.
Section 5
The Final Promise
  • 5.1 When a Seeker has learned sufficiently from many worlds, the Goddess reveals the path to their Final Resting Place.
  • 5.2 In the Final Virtual World, the Seeker dwells eternally, united with the Goddess in the digital cosmos.

Rituals of the Church

Core rites are practiced daily and weekly by all Seekers, with clear structure and purpose.

Ritual

The Cleansing

  • Performed prior to each Ceremony or Ritual
  • Physical cleaning of controllers/equipment
  • Moment of quiet focus and intention

Purpose: prepares sacred tools and signals the transition from ordinary activity to worship.

Ceremony

The First Ceremony

  • Daily; must begin before sunrise (local time)
  • Minimum length: 2 hours
  • Opening prayer (“Be Better”), focused gameplay, closing gratitude

Purpose: aligns the Seeker’s will with growth, discipline, and initiative.

Ceremony

The Second Ceremony

  • Daily; later in the day
  • Minimum length: 2 hours
  • Structure mirrors the First Ceremony

Purpose: reinforces lessons, prevents stagnation, and encourages perseverance.

Practice

Changing of Worlds

  • As required, after a world’s fulfillment
  • Transition to a new game/virtual world

Purpose: honors variety and ensures continual exploration.

Community

Communal Pilgrimages

  • As designated by Council/community
  • Online or in-person group gameplay

Purpose: shared learning, mutual support, reinforcement of doctrine.

Community

Reflections & Horns

  • Reflections of Discovery: at least weekly, verbal or written
  • Blowing of the Horns: at least weekly celebration

Purpose: teaching, preservation of lessons, communal recognition.

Health

Care of the Physical Body

  • Daily
  • Minimum one hour outdoors in contemplation or exercise

Purpose: balance physical and virtual life; prevent harm or neglect.
